Think Atheist is proud to announce that it will be holding regular monthly meetings to discuss topics of interest and simply enjoy the company of other free-thinkers! The site founder, Morgan Matthew, will be in attendance, as well as site administrators, Cara Coleen and Robert Karp.
We are open to topic suggestions! Also, the Reason Rally is just around the corner; we can go as a group to that event, and to other future events. We hope this group will evolve into a fun and useful resource for local atheists/agnostics/free-thinkers.
Please RSVP so we can decide on an appropriate venue to gather. Each monthly meet-up will be listed as an event, so RSVP to each. Thanks!
If you are not in the Baltimore area but would like to host your own Think Atheist meet-up, please feel free to contact Morgan Mathew.
Directions
To reach Ukazoo Books by car, take I-695 (Baltimore Beltway) toward Towson. Take exit 27A for Dulaney Valley Rd/MD-146 S toward Towson. Dulaney Plaza will be on your right after approximately half a mile. The bookstore is located in the back of the plaza.
